Life-size draped classical male ship’s figurehead of English 19th century origin. The carving is quite similar to that of the figurehead rescued from the HMS Leander circa 1848 and carved by the Hellyer’s of Portsmouth and Cosham. Our figurehead, while exhibiting a quite typical vertical crack, does not exhibit much wood loss. We left it “as found” as to allow the collector his or her own scraping or repainting. Some early pigments remain.
